How To Fix HRBENUS_ACA107 - No reporting ALE found for transmitting ALE &1


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: HRBENUS_ACA - Affordable Care Act System Messages

  • Message number: 107

  • Message text: No reporting ALE found for transmitting ALE &1

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message HRBENUS_ACA107 - No reporting ALE found for transmitting ALE &1 ?

    The SAP error message HRBENUS_ACA107 indicates that there is no reporting Application Link Enabling (ALE) found for the specified transmitting ALE. This error typically occurs in the context of the Affordable Care Act (ACA) reporting process in the SAP Human Capital Management (HCM) module, particularly when dealing with the transmission of ACA-related data.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Configuration: The error often arises when the necessary ALE configuration for transmitting ACA data is not set up correctly in the system.
    2. Incorrect Partner Profile: The partner profile for the ALE distribution may not be correctly defined or may be missing.
    3. Inconsistent Data: There may be inconsistencies or missing data in the records that are supposed to be transmitted.
    4. Transport Issues: There could be issues related to the transport of the ALE settings from one system to another (e.g., from development to production).

    Solution:

    1. Check ALE Configuration:

      • Go to transaction WE20 to check the partner profiles. Ensure that the correct partner profiles for the transmitting ALE are defined.
      • Verify that the necessary logical systems are set up correctly in transaction SALE.
    2. Review the Customizing Settings:

      • Navigate to the ACA reporting customizing settings in the SAP system. Ensure that all necessary settings for ACA reporting are correctly configured.
      • Check the settings under SPRO > Personnel Management > Employee Benefits > ACA Reporting.
    3. Validate Data:

      • Ensure that the data being transmitted is complete and consistent. Check for any missing or incorrect entries in the employee records that may affect the reporting.
    4. Check for Notes and Updates:

      • Look for any SAP Notes related to ACA reporting and ALE configuration. There may be updates or corrections provided by SAP that address this specific issue.
    5. Test the Transmission:

      • After making the necessary adjustments, perform a test transmission to see if the error persists. Use transaction PC00_M40_CEAC to generate the ACA reports and check if the ALE transmission works correctly.
    6. Consult Documentation:

      • Review the SAP documentation related to ACA reporting and ALE configuration for any additional guidance or troubleshooting steps.
